If you are paying for your own wedding, you might consider opening a bank account exclusively for wedding-related expenses. By knowing exactly how much money you have to work with, it will help you stick to your budget. Even if you aren't engaged, it doesn't hurt to start a fund for your eventual wedding, however far down the line.
Post a schedule of events on your wedding website or send an itinerary with your wedding invitations. This helps out-of-town guests make appropriate travel plans, especially guests who are going to participate in your wedding rehearsal or other events. Let people be aware of the events, such as rehearsals and the things that they must come to, so that they could be there at the appropriate time.
Different countries have plants that are not always native to where you live and may not be easily accessible, or be able to tolerate an extremely humid, or dry environment. Call ahead or look online to determine which flowers are available in your destination country during the time your wedding will occur.
Make sure that the venue you choose for your reception has adequate space for dancing. You can make room by moving some chairs and tables around when it's time to dance, just make sure you find enough space for people to get their groove on.

If you want to discover local talent to assist with your wedding, try Craigslist. Meet the professional in person with your fiance before signing any contracts or handing over money.
If you are going to be giving one of the wedding speeches, make sure you plan it out and practice enough. If you do not plan your speech, you may cause the audience to stop paying attention, or you just might get stage fright.
